One of the most popular UK online news platforms is the BBC News website, which provides up-to-date coverage of national and international news, as well as in-depth analysis and features. The BBC is known for its impartial reporting, and its website is a go-to source for many Brits seeking news and information.
Another prominent UK online news platform is The Guardian, a left-leaning newspaper that has been in publication since 1821. The Guardian’s website offers a wide range of news, opinion, and feature articles, as well as in-depth coverage of politics, business, and culture. The Guardian is also known for its investigative journalism and has won numerous awards for its reporting.
The Telegraph is another well-established UK online news platform, with a long history dating back to 1803. The Telegraph’s website offers a broad range of news, opinion, and feature articles, as well as in-depth coverage of politics, business, and culture. The Telegraph is known for its conservative leanings and has a strong following among those who support the Conservative Party.
Other notable UK online news platforms include The Independent, The Times, and The Daily Mail, each with its own unique perspective and focus. The Independent is a left-leaning newspaper that has been in publication since 1986, while The Times is a broadsheet newspaper that has been in publication since 1785. The Daily Mail is a tabloid newspaper that has been in publication since 1896 and is known for its sensationalist reporting and conservative leanings.

Specialized News Platforms in the UK
In the UK, there are numerous online news platforms that cater to specific interests, regions, and demographics. These specialized news platforms provide in-depth coverage of niche topics, making them essential for individuals seeking targeted information. Here are some notable examples:
The Guardian’s Environment and Science sections offer comprehensive coverage of environmental issues, climate change, and scientific breakthroughs. The platform’s dedicated team of journalists and experts provide insightful analysis and commentary on these critical topics.
The Financial Times’ (FT) coverage of business, finance, and economics is unparalleled. The FT’s online platform features expert analysis, news, and commentary on global financial markets, companies, and industries.
The BBC’s dedicated news sections, such as BBC Newsbeat and BBC Local News, focus on youth-oriented and regional news, respectively. These platforms provide a unique perspective on issues affecting young people and local communities.
The Telegraph’s coverage of politics, foreign affairs, and defence is highly regarded. The platform’s team of experienced journalists and commentators provide in-depth analysis and commentary on these critical topics.
The Independent’s online platform features a range of topics, including politics, culture, and lifestyle. The platform’s editorial team is known for its progressive and liberal perspective, making it a popular choice for those seeking alternative viewpoints.
Other notable specialized news platforms in the UK include:
• The Conversation, a non-profit platform featuring expert commentary and analysis on a range of topics, including politics, science, and culture.
• Open Democracy, a platform focused on democracy, politics, and human rights, featuring in-depth analysis and commentary from experts and journalists.
• The New Statesman, a left-leaning magazine and online platform featuring coverage of politics, culture, and society.
